Technical Foundation and Site Architecture

Industrial sites often house thousands of PDFs and technical specs. Ensuring Google can crawl and index these efficiently is critical for visibility.

Optimize PDF Technical Data Sheets for Indexing Engineers often search for specific part numbers or tolerances found only in PDFs. Ensure these files have descriptive titles and internal links. Tools: Adobe Acrobat, Google Search Console

Implement Industry-Specific Schema Markup Use Product schema for individual components and LocalBusiness schema for regional distribution centers or plants. Tools: Schema.org, Validator.schema.org

Audit Site Speed for Plant-Floor Access Users on plant floors often have poor connectivity. A fast-loading site ensures they can access spec sheets without delay. Tools: PageSpeed Insights, GTmetrix

Configure Secure HTTPS for Proprietary IP Industrial buyers need to know their project data and RFQ details are transmitted securely. Tools: SSL Certificate Provider

On-Page Optimization and Technical Content

On-page SEO for manufacturing must focus on the language of the engineer: part numbers, tolerances, and material grades.

Optimize for Part Numbers and SKUs Many industrial searches are highly specific. Ensure every SKU and part number has a dedicated, indexable section or page. Tools: Keyword Planner, SEMRush

Create Comparison Tables for Material Grades Helping buyers compare 304 vs 316 stainless steel, for example, captures users in the consideration phase. Tools: Google Search Console

Develop Technical Glossary Pages Defining industry terms like ISO 9001 compliance or CNC tolerances builds topical authority. Tools: Internal Subject Matter Experts

Optimize Images with Alt Text for CAD and Drawings Engineers often use Image Search to find component designs. Use descriptive alt text for blueprints and CAD previews. Tools: Screaming Frog

Conversion Rate Optimization (CRO) for RFQs

Traffic is useless if it does not lead to a Request for Quote. Your site must be optimized for the industrial buyer journey.

Streamline the RFQ Form Reduce friction. Only ask for essential data: material, quantity, and CAD file upload. Tools: Hotjar, Google Analytics 4

Add Clear Call-to-Actions (CTAs) on Spec Pages Every technical page should lead directly to an RFQ or a 'Consult an Engineer' button. Tools: CMS Editor

Implement Trust Signals and Certifications Display ISO, AS9100, or ITAR certifications prominently in the header or footer. Tools: Graphic Design

Authority Building and Off-Page SEO

In the industrial sector, authority is built through niche associations and technical credibility.

Claim and Optimize Thomasnet and IndustryNet Profiles These are the primary directories for industrial procurement. Backlinks from these sites carry significant weight. Tools: Thomasnet, IndustryNet

Secure Backlinks from Trade Associations Links from organizations like the National Association of Manufacturers (NAM) boost niche relevance. Tools: Ahrefs, Manual Outreach

Publish White Papers and Case Studies Deep-dive content into specific engineering challenges attracts high-quality backlinks from industry publications. Tools: Internal Engineering Team

Common Oversights

Hiding technical specifications behind a login or 'Request Access' wall, which prevents search engines from indexing the data.

Using generic stock photos of 'business people' instead of actual facility equipment and finished parts.

Neglecting the 'industrial seo mistakes' of over-optimizing for broad terms like 'manufacturing' instead of specific capabilities like 'precision swiss turning'.

In the manufacturing sector, SEO typically takes 6 to 12 months to show significant impact on RFQ volume. This is due to the technical nature of the content and the competitive landscape of B2B search. However, niche manufacturers targeting specific part numbers or specialized processes often see 'quick wins' within 3 to 4 months as they begin to rank for long-tail, high-intent queries that competitors have neglected.
